Biological optical measurement instrument and method for displaying information relating to necessity/unnecessity of replacement of light-emitting unit
Abstract
Disclosed is a biological optical measurement instrument provided with: a light source unit which has a light-emitting unit that emits light and irradiates the light to an object; a light measurement unit configured to measure passing light at a measurement point of the object: a signal processing unit configured to process hemoglobin information outputted from the light measurement unit and create a light measurement image; and a display unit configured to display the light measurement image, further provided with a measurement/determination unit configured to measure the deterioration state of the light-emitting unit from the light output of the light-emitting unit and an electric current injected into the light-emitting unit and determine the necessity/unnecessity of replacement of the light-emitting unit, wherein the display unit displays information relating to the necessity/unnecessity of replacing the light-emitting unit determined by the measurement/determination unit.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A biological optical measurement instrument comprising:
a light source unit which has light-emitting units that emit light, configured to irradiate the light to an object to be examined; a light measurement unit configured to measure the transmitted light at a measurement point in the object; a signal processing unit configured to process the hemoglobin information outputted from the light measurement unit and create a light measurement image; and a display unit configured to display the light measurement image, further comprising a measurement/determination unit configured to measure the deterioration state of the light-emitting unit based on the light output of the light-emitting unit and the current injected into the light-emitting unit, and determines the necessity/unnecessity of replacement of the light-emitting unit, wherein the display unit displays the information on the necessity/unnecessity of replacing the light-emitting unit which is determined by the measurement/determination unit.
2 . The biological optical measurement instrument according to claim 1 , wherein the measurement/determination unit, when the current injected into the light-emitting unit surpasses the absolute rated current, determines that the light-emitting unit needs to be replaced.
3 . The biological optical measurement instrument according to claim 1 , wherein the measurement/determination unit, when the light output does not reach a predetermined value at the time that the absolute rated current is injected into the light-emitting unit, determines that the light-emitting unit needs to be replaced.
4 . The biological optical measurement instrument according to claim 1 , wherein the measurement/determination unit, when the current injected into the light-emitting unit reaches a current value which is smaller than the absolute rated value for the portion of a predetermined value, determines that the light-emitting unit needs to be replaced.
5 . The biological optical measurement instrument according to claim 1 , wherein the measurement/determination unit, when the current injected into the light-emitting unit does not reach a current value which is smaller than the absolute rated current for the portion of a predetermined value, determines that the light-emitting unit does not need to be replaced.
6 . The biological optical measurement instrument according to claim 1 , wherein the measurement/determination unit, when the light-output starting current at which the light output of the light-emitting unit is started is greater than a predetermined value, determines that the light-emitting unit needs to be replaced.
7 . The biological optical measurement instrument according to claim 1 , wherein the measurement/determination unit, when the current corresponding to a light output which is smaller than the light output is smaller than the absolute rated current, determines that the light-emitting unit does not need to be.
8 . The biological optical measurement instrument according to claim 1 , wherein the measurement/determination unit, when the value of slope in a graph based on the light output and the current of the light-emitting unit reaches smaller than a predetermined value, determines that the light-emitting unit needs to be replaced.
9 . The biological optical measurement instrument according to claim 8 , wherein the measurement/determination unit marks a predetermined light output in the graph, and determines, when the current corresponding to a predetermined light output surpasses the absolute rated current, that the light-emitting unit needs to be replaced.
10 . The biological optical measurement instrument according to claim 1 , comprising a usable-period calculation unit configured to calculate the timing that the current reaches the absolute rated current and the usable period according to the graph based on the current corresponding to the light output of the light-emitting unit and time, wherein the measurement/determination unit determines the necessity/unnecessity of replacement of the light-emitting unit on the basis of the timing that the current reaches the absolute rated current and the estimated usable period.
11 . The biological optical measurement instrument according to claim 1 , comprising a light-emitting unit condition measuring unit configured to measure the deterioration state of the light-emitting unit on the basis of the gain value which is set, on the basis of the light quantity of the transmitted light measured by the light emitting unit, by the gain adjustment unit that sets a gain value by which the digital signal based on the hemoglobin information is multiplied, wherein the measurement/determination unit determines the necessity/unnecessity of replacement of the light-emitting unit from the deterioration state thereof.
12 . The biological optical measurement instrument according to claim 11 , wherein light-emitting unit condition measuring unit measures the deterioration state of the light-emitting unit by the ratio between the gain value at the time of shipment and the current gain value.
13 . The biological optical measurement instrument according to claim 1 , comprising an ammeter configured to measure a current, between an optical module provided with a modulator that modulates the light emitted by the light-emitting unit by a plurality of different frequencies and the light-emitting unit.
14 . The biological optical measurement instrument according to claim 1 , wherein the light-emitting unit emits near-infrared light that includes a semiconductor laser or light-emitting diode.
15 . A method for displaying information regarding the necessity/unnecessity of replacement of a light-emitting unit including steps of:
